Pregnancy whilst IUCD in-situ

Authoring team

Consult expert advice.

If a woman becomes pregnant with an intrauterine pregnancy, advise removal of the intrauterine device (IUD) or intrauterine system (IUS)/Mirena coil before 12 weeks' gestation, whether or not she intends to continue the pregnancy
